Dubai Municipality has launched the Dubai nanoparticle detection laboratory as part of its efforts to strengthen food safety standards and enhance regulatory oversight across the emirate’s food sector.
Operated by Dubai Central Laboratory, the new facility uses advanced ICP-MS technology to detect titanium dioxide nanoparticles in processed food products accurately. The laboratory can deliver test results in less than five minutes, allowing authorities to respond more quickly to food safety requirements while supporting Dubai’s position as a leader in laboratory testing and quality assurance.
The initiative comes at a time when nanotechnology is being increasingly used in food manufacturing to improve product characteristics such as colour, texture, and stability. By expanding its testing capabilities, Dubai Municipality aims to ensure that food products available in the market continue to meet approved safety and quality standards.
Faster and More Accurate Food Testing
The laboratory relies on advanced analytical technologies that can measure particle size, distribution, and other physical and chemical properties with a high degree of accuracy. These capabilities enable specialists to distinguish between conventional titanium dioxide and nanoparticle-sized forms used in processed food products.

According to Dubai Municipality, the facility can process approximately 60 samples per day, with capacity increasing to 100 samples daily during emergencies. The ability to complete testing quickly helps accelerate regulatory procedures and supports decision-making based on reliable scientific data.
Eng. Hind Mahmoud Ahmed, Director of the Dubai Central Laboratory Department, said the new laboratory represents an important addition to the specialised services offered by Dubai Central Laboratory. She noted that the facility will support regulatory authorities and partners in both the public and private sectors through advanced analytical solutions that keep pace with technological developments.
Supporting Future Research and Innovation
Beyond food testing, the laboratory is expected to support future research and applications involving nanoparticles in sectors such as cosmetics, pharmaceuticals, and packaging materials. The initiative could also contribute to the development of policies and regulations governing the use of nanotechnology in consumer products.
The launch follows the introduction of the ViruGenetics laboratory, the UAE’s first specialised facility for detecting foodborne viruses using advanced genomic technologies.
